T.C. Saglik Bakanligi Accelerates Data Transfer by 90% by Capturing Data Online

Overview T.C. Saglik Bakanligi wanted to modernize and standardize information systems used by hospitals to improve quality of care and operational efficiency and ensure availability of patient data when and where it is needed to enable informed and often life-saving care decisions. The challenge was to enable access to real time business information to drive more informed operational decisions and eliminate legacy physical data transfer processes, in which data was collected from hospitals via CD-ROM and other physical media. T.C. Saglik Bakanligi implemented a new data infrastructure based on Oracle Database, allowing for rapid access and delivery of patient, administrative, and financial data and achieved around-the-clock availability of all data, from financial data to patient records, by implementing Oracle Real Application Clusters.
